myBatis if문에서 null 체크

동적 SQL문을 작성하는데,if문에 적은 내용이 !=null 말고 빈문자열 여부도 확인해주어야 하는 경우였다.그런데 아래와 같이 쓰니 조건식이 제대로 작동하지 않았다.검색해보니 이는 if문에 객체에 대한 표현식을 문자열로 쓸 수 있게 해주는, OGNL의 문제였는데OGN

2022년 8월 3일
·
0개의 댓글
·
post-thumbnail

DB에서 특정 기간의 예약 가능한 숙소를 다중조건으로 조회하기

현재 진행 중인 스프링 팀 프로젝트에서 나는 숙소 검색 및 조회 부분을 맡고 있고, 어제 오늘 다중조건 검색 기능을 구현했다. 검색 결과를 조회하는 화면을 요청하는 두 가지 방식이 있는데 구현 내용 (1) 홈 화면에서 각 숙소유형(모텔,호텔,게스트하우스,...)을 클

2022년 8월 3일
·
0개의 댓글
·

mybatis 여러 개의 태그를 동시 조건으로 조회하기, #과 $의 차이

화면에서 태그를 선택하면, 해당 태그를 가지고 있는 강의를 조회한다. 하나의 강의는 여러 개의 태그를 가질 수 있다. 또 하나의 태그에 대해서 이를 가진 강의가 여러 개 있을 수 있다. (M:N) 검색조건에 따라 강의 정보를 조회하는 쿼리를 작성할 때 원래는 아래처럼 여러 개의 태그를 선택했을 때, 그 중 하나라도 해당이 되는 강의는 모두 조회하도록 했다...

2022년 7월 24일
·
0개의 댓글
·